Each tapestry is hand-painted in Nara, Japan by Yoshioka-san herself.
These tapestries are made of ramie, an extremely durable and lustrous fiber that is similar to linen, and often used in ultra-high-class designerwear clothing. Ramie, also called China grass, boasts a high resistance to bacteria, mildrew, rotting, and insect attacks, as well as a natural stain-resisting ability.

Heavenly Bamboo, or "Nanten", is known for the leaves and berries that change colors throughout the year. This tapestry depicts the plant during the change of seasons from late summer to autumn, with its bright red, ripe berries and green foliage starting to just turn color. The gold accents in the leaves add a vibrant touch to this authentic tapestry.
